What is BYOD?

Bring Your Own Device (BYOD) is a program that allows high school students to bring their own laptops or tablets to school. This makes learning more personalized, convenient, and effective by integrating technology into the classroom.

Choosing the Right Laptop for Your Child

As a parent, selecting the right laptop for your child can be challenging. With so many options available, it's important to choose a device that will best support their learning journey. Here are some key factors to consider when choosing a laptop for your school-aged child:

  • Performance: Look for a laptop with at least 8GB of RAM and a modern processor to handle school tasks smoothly.
  • Battery Life: A long-lasting battery is essential for all-day learning without constant recharging.
  • Durability: Choose a laptop that is built to withstand daily use and potential bumps or drops.
  • Portability: Consider a lightweight and compact model that your child can easily carry between school and home.
